Hair is one of the most important parts of a person's appearance.
It's important to take care of it properly to keep it healthy and beautiful.
Take care of your hair, we can help!
1853 products
-
L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 6.23 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 6.23 50ml (1.69fl oz)
- Regular price
-
R 179.00 - Regular price
-
R 337.00 - Sale price
-
R 179.00
-
L'Oréal Professionnel Dia Richesse SP .24 Rose Gold Milkshake 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se SP .24 Rose Gold Milkshake 50ml (1.69fl oz)
- Regular price
-
R 171.00 - Regular price
-
R 337.00 - Sale price
-
R 171.00
-
L'Oréal Professionnel Dia Richesse SP .11 Silver Milkshake 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se SP .11 Silver Milkshake 50ml (1.69fl oz)
- Regular price
-
R 175.00 - Regular price
-
R 337.00 - Sale price
-
R 175.00
-
L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 5.31 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 5.31 50ml (1.69fl oz)
- Regular price
-
R 175.00 - Regular price
-
R 281.00 - Sale price
-
R 175.00
-
L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 8.31 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 8.31 50ml (1.69fl oz)
- Regular price
-
R 141.00 - Regular price
-
R 281.00 - Sale price
-
R 141.00
-
L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 5.8 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 5.8 50ml (1.69fl oz)
- Regular price
-
R 162.00 - Regular price
-
R 281.00 - Sale price
-
R 162.00
-
L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 5.3 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 5.3 50ml (1.69fl oz)
- Regular price
-
R 153.00 - Regular price
-
R 281.00 - Sale price
-
R 153.00
-
L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 7.13 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 7.13 50ml (1.69fl oz)
- Regular price
-
R 141.00 - Regular price
-
R 281.00 - Sale price
-
R 141.00
-
L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 4.62 50ml (1.69fl oz)Vendor:L'Oréal Professionnel Dia Richesse Semi-Permanent Hair Dye 4.62 50ml (1.69fl oz)
- Regular price
-
R 165.00 - Regular price
-
R 281.00 - Sale price
-
R 165.00
-
L'Oréal Professionnel Inoa Mochas Permanent Hair Dye 5.8 60g (2.12oz)Vendor:L'Oréal Professionnel Inoa Mochas Permanent Hair Dye 5.8 60g (2.12oz)
- Regular price
-
R 214.00 - Regular price
-
R 402.00 - Sale price
-
R 214.00
-
L'Oréal Professionnel Inoa Permanent Hair Dye 9.3 60g (2.12oz)Vendor:L'Oréal Professionnel Inoa Permanent Hair Dye 9.3 60g (2.12oz)
- Regular price
-
R 123.00 - Regular price
-
R 402.00 - Sale price
-
R 123.00
-
L'Oréal Professionnel Inoa Permanent Hair Dye 8.31 60g (2.12oz)Vendor:L'Oréal Professionnel Inoa Permanent Hair Dye 8.31 60g (2.12oz)
- Regular price
-
R 173.00 - Regular price
-
R 286.00 - Sale price
-
R 173.00